On not coming back from losing positions, it feels like we don't have that unpredictable spark that we've maybe had in the past, with Bradley or bringing on a Dapo or a Sadlier to doing something unusual.  Once a team is ahead, they've got us where they want us, they know we generally aren't going to do something they can't deal if they are organised and defensive - dribbling past 2 men, a great shot from distance, unless its a  Toal or Iredale header from a corner (if Morley doesn't beat the first man that's not happening). 

Away we've scored first an amazing 8 times, and won 7 of them.  A brilliant record, just the blip at Reading.  The other incredible stat away is that we haven't conceded before the 45th minute away yet (surely no team in the Prem/EFL can match that).  But as you say there is little evidence that we can come back from a losing position, with just the draw at Burton and now 2 limp defeats.  First goal away from home appears to be decisive with our current squad.  Not as obvious to call in home games as of the 4 times we've conceded first, a sending off has spoiled the game Iin 3 of them and in the other one it was all over before H-T.
